What Does It Mean to Be a Co-Creator with God?

What if you're not here just to receive God's blessings — but to actively create with God? In this uplifting Sunday message, "What Does It Mean to Be a Co-Creator with God?" Rev. Sharon Renae unpacks one of Unity's most empowering teachings: that you are not a passive observer of your life, but a willing partner with the Divine. Drawing from Matthew 28:19 and the Unity metaphysical interpretation of the Trinity — Divine Mind, Divine Idea, and Divine Expression — this message reframes what it means to be made in God's image. Creation didn't stop in Genesis. It continues through you, every time you say yes. Too often, we wait until we feel ready, qualified, or certain. But what if the nudge you keep ignoring IS the invitation? Through New Thought principles, real-life insight, and a healthy dose of spiritual honesty, Rev. Sharon reveals that co-creating with God isn't complicated — it starts with one simple (and sometimes terrifying) word: Yes. You are not too old. You are not too late. You are already the Divine's idea in motion.
